Блокнот ++ Найти / Заменить


4

Я ищу способ сделать поиск / замену в документе, который заменит переменную с полями из другого документа.

Таким образом, в документации есть несколько примеров следующего:

int <x/y>
int <x/y>
int <x/y>

На второй документ я бы

3/1
3/2
3/2

Я хочу найти и заменить данными другого документа, начиная с 3/1

В итоге мой 1-й документ выглядел бы так

int 3/1
int 3/2
int 3/3

Есть ли способ настроить это? Спасибо


Возможно, вы могли бы записать макрос и воспроизвести его
Сатьяджит Бхат

Поможет ли копировать / вставить столбец? Alt + Mouse (или Alt + Shift + Arrow) для выбора, затем Ctrl + C, Ctrl + V.
Уилсон

Ответы:


1

Если вы хотите создать сценарий для этого на постоянной основе, я не думаю, что есть способ немного заняться программированием.

Нечто подобное можно сделать, как предложил Сатья, записывая макрос, я бы не стал этого предлагать. Или, возможно, исследовать простой пакетный сценарий в Windows (возможно, лучшее решение). Я сам считаю, что использовать пакет для циклов с токенами намного сложнее, чем в реальных языках программирования.

Я сам предпочел бы делать это на реальном языке программирования, подобные вещи действительно просты в python или любом из языков c.

Используйте StackOverflow в качестве ресурса для помощи, если вы решите пойти по этому пути.

Обновить

Еще одно предложение, о котором я подумал, возможно, это использование Excel. Я не знаю, какой формат вы вынуждены использовать, но если вы можете переключиться на разделитель того, что ваш формат сейчас, вы можете быстро сделать все это в Excel. В противном случае вам придется погрузиться в программирование.


Моя была больше похожа на половину предложения :) Я действительно сомневаюсь, что это возможно без изрядного количества сценариев / программирования
Сатьяджит Бхат

@ Сатья согласился, я так не думаю.
Джеймс
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.